Last but not least was TB Dinesh, who presented his work with Janastu, and Servelots. He is building free and open source technologies to address the needs of populations in the Global South, particularly indigenous communities and those experiencing systemic inequity and prejudice. Dinesh’s passion is building the tools for a truly inclusive Web, one that takes into account that still a large population of the world have low reading literacy.

Dinesh is based in a village that lies on top of a hill next to a valley, about one hour from the city of Bangalore in India. A mesh network connects his village to other villages across the valley.


Janastu has built a radio storytelling platform atop that mesh network, enabling people to share their stories and knowledge using audio and visual media. They converted old phone booths into nodes for the radio, called Namdu1Radio. They are equipped with Raspberry Pis that allow people to walk up to listen to other people’s recordings or record their own with a push of a button. Dinesh noted that making the technology approachable this way is crucial. By making use of familiar infrastructure, like a phone booth, you can more easily embed new technology.

Dinesh and his team have created hypermedia archives, using image-based web annotation technology to connect audio to other audio. Like hypertext, where text documents are interconnected with other text documents through links, hypermedia does the same using media. The archive tool allows people to drag-and-drop images to associate them to audio files.

Their hypermedia project has been underway for several years. What have they had to change since the COVID lockdowns? This year, Janastu was planning to go to another village and build out their mesh network, radio, and hypermedia archive in an area 2000km away. The pandemic forced them to indefinitely postpone that project.

Now Dinesh and his team are building what he calls a “mesh mash” — a mesh network with an overlay or logical network. Since building out the physical mesh network is difficult under the lockdown, they are enabling other devices, such as laptops or tablets connected through mobile cell service, to be part of the mesh.

They use IPv6 identifiers to allow those devices to connect and access the other nodes on the network. The mesh mash uses Syncthing to keep files synchronized and up-to-date across the mesh network. They use Yggdrasil to configure log-ins and host video streamed workshops that are broadcast across the network.

Dinesh is currently building out Papad, the audio annotation tool. Like the hypermedia archives, the images can be dragged and dropped to related audio files. People can also add text tags to add another layer of annotation. For example, if an audio recording is about a math lesson, someone could find an image of numbers and arithmetic operators and add that to the audio file. This is all updated and available across the mesh network.

Janastu Mesh Network Diagram
This allows people to not only contribute their knowledge and stories to the mesh network. It empowers people to organize and archive this shared knowledge so it’s discoverable, all without needing to be able to read or write. This shared hypermedia archive enables people to connect across similar interests, share recipes, and even offer gig services across the villages.


Dinesh’s projects emerge out of a passion for creating technology that is community maintained and developed. He believes in the potential of technology, combined with locally-available resources and knowledge, to bring about local futures that are more equitable and self-determining.
